Description
Available in both print and PDA formats, The Cardiology Intensive Board Review Question Book is a highly focused question-and-answer review geared specifically to candidates taking the Cardiovascular Boards and the Cardiovascular section of the Internal Medicine Boards, whether for initial certification or for recertification. It contains over 700 questions with answers and succinct explanations, focusing on the specific areas tested. Content areas are covered in the same proportion as on the actual exam to ensure highly targeted, high-yield preparation. The book includes more than 100 echocardiograms, electrocardiograms, angiograms, magnetic resonance images, and other illustrations to reinforce key concepts. The PDA version's intuitive, easy to navigate programme allows movement within topics with a single touch. Users can add information and it is automatically integrated into the document. The PDA version is available for Palm OS handhelds and Pocket PC and Windows CE operating systems
